The top 16 men in recurve and compound and eight women each in both the sections were selected based on their performance at the National Archery Championship, held in Chennai last December, Jharkhand Archery Association sources said today.
Eight junior archers in men and women in recurve and compound were picked based on their performance in the last Junior National championship, they said.
Top rung archers Deepika Kumari (women's recurve) Rahul Banerjee (men's recurve), Ch. Jignas (men's compound) and Jyothi Surekha (women's compound) will take part in the meet, which will see participation from over 100 archers.
A Naik, an army subedar and 19-year-old Ch. Jignas, Vijayawada-based Volga Archery academy's favourite archer, grabbed the gold in the individual segment by defeating China's He Ying 145-142 in the 1st Asian Grand Prix at Bangkok last month.
He, along with Sandeep Kumar and Abhishek Varma clinched the team gold by outplaying Vietnam in the final.
Another archer from Vijayawada, top ranked Jyothi Surekha, did not take part in the Bangkok tourney as she was appearing for her intermediate exams.
